Il sistema dei nomi di dominio , o DNS , traduce i nomi di dominio umano - friendly come microsoft.com in Internet Protocol, o IP, indirizzi come 207.46.197.32 . Quando si digita un nome di dominio nella barra degli indirizzi del browser Web , il computer invia una richiesta al server DNS , per chiedere l'indirizzo IP corrispondente . Il server DNS risponde con l' indirizzo IP, che il computer utilizza poi per affrontare pacchetti TCP destinati a server del sito Web per richiedere una pagina Web o di altri dati .
Ricerche DNS
ricerche DNS prendere tempo , in quanto la query per il nome dell'indirizzo IP del dominio deve viaggiare al server DNS, che cerca le informazioni richieste . Se il server DNS non è in grado di rispondere la query , passa la query a un altro server DNS a monte della catena , fino a quando la query raggiunge un server in grado di fornire i dati richiesti . Anche se questo accade di solito nel giro di mezzo secondo , alcune query possono prendere un secondo o più , la creazione di un ritardo notevole durante la navigazione .
Prelettura DNS
prelettura DNS , noto anche come pre - risolutivo , aiuta a velocizzare l'esperienza di navigazione per andare a prendere automaticamente le informazioni DNS prima che venga richiesto . Se si va in un motore di ricerca , ad esempio , quando il browser viene visualizzata la pagina dei risultati , si avvierà automaticamente la risoluzione del DNS per ogni risultato . Con il tempo che l'utente ha letto i risultati e selezionato un collegamento per esplorare ulteriormente , le informazioni DNS per il dominio scelto sarà già nella cache del browser . Ciò significa che quando si fa clic su un link , il browser può andare direttamente al sito, senza dover attendere il siti DNS per risolvere prima . Questo può rendere l'esperienza di navigazione notevolmente più liscia ed eliminare inutili ritardi .
Quali browser Implementazione di pre -fetching ?
Google Chrome è stato uno dei primi browser per implementare DNS pre - recupero , ed è ora incluso nelle ultime versioni di tutti i principali browser . Mozilla Firefox ha aggiunto il supporto per la prelettura DNS in versione 3.5 , ed è incluso in tutte le versioni future . Microsoft Internet Explorer 9 supporta pre -fetching , con un terzo plug-in disponibili per aggiungere il supporto a Internet Explorer 7 e 8 . Browser Safari di Apple è dotato di prelettura DNS disponibile nelle versioni 5.01 e superiori .
networking © www.354353.com